We discovered a new unique place worth seeing. A 3-5 hour drive south of Vientiane are caves Konglor of Khammouane province.

 

A little theory on Khammouane in Laos and Tha Khaek

Travelers often use Province Khammuan as the gateway between Thailand and Vietnam, in the direction of more popular destinations such as the 4000 islands and Champassak . Yet Khammouane has a better potential for trekking and tour the rest of southern Laos. The poor condition of roads and lack of infrastructure are hampering the tourist development.

Far on small winding streets , in the heart of mountainous rural asleep in time found the gate of the park. We support a small entrance to our car park for us before parking on uneven ground price. Definitely this place is not the most popular attraction for tourist buses . The counter to pay admission asks us 100,000 kip per boat and 5,000 kip per person is about $ 15. You can rent headlamps and accessories for one dollar. I advise you to take because the cave is dark.

Here are the highlights of this adventure :

– The huge cave ceilings can reach more than 30 meters at its maximum

 

– The guide is not very talkative on tour in silence. learn to have an English speaking guide

 

– The cave is dark , bring to light what must have had a better lighting system at the beginning flew more than 10 years

 

– Bring warm clothes, it’s cold and wet outside compared

 

– It takes about an hour of discovery and navigation before exiting the other side of the mountain

 

– The end of the tunnel in a dense jungle out of nowhere is the highlight of this expedition

 

– There are not many tourists and so much the better . It would lose its charm.

 

– A stop of 45 minutes to the other camps listed is made or can be cool and talk about the adventure before returned to the starting point of the other sides of the mountain

 

– The tunnel is the only means of communication with the outside and goods for the people side of the drill .à
